Buying Guide: Key Purchase Considerations

  • Well depth and head: Determine the maximum head you need. Deeper wells and longer lift require pumps with higher head ratings.
  • Flow requirements: Match GPM to your usage. Household farming and irrigation benefit from higher flow, but ensure your power supply supports it.
  • Voltage and wiring: Confirm local electrical standards. Many pumps run at 110V, 230V, or higher. Verify wiring, circuit capacity, and cord length.
  • Material and durability: Stainless steel bodies resist corrosion and extend life in water. Copper motors improve longevity and efficiency.
  • Well outlet and casing size: Ensure the pump’s outlet and fit match your piping and well casing. Larger diameters demand compatible fittings.
  • Control features: External control boxes offer switching convenience but add wiring considerations. Built-in check valves reduce external hardware needs.
  • Dry-run protection: Many models include protections to prevent damage when water is low or absent.
  • Installation considerations: Some units are easier to install without a pump house; others require more space and secure mounting.

Common buyer questions

  • What does “head” mean in a well pump? It is the maximum vertical distance the pump can push water, measured in feet or meters.
  • Is a higher GPM always better? Not necessarily; it must match your water demand without overloading the pump.
  • What is an external control box? It is a separate device that houses switches and protection features for easy operation.
  • Can I install these pumps myself? Basic installation is possible with electrical and plumbing know-how; professional help may be needed for high-flow or high-voltage models.
  • Should I protect the pump from running dry? Yes; many models warn against dry-running to prevent motor damage.
  • How long do these pumps last? Durability depends on material quality, water quality, and operating conditions.
